(PAGASA 24-HOUR PUBLIC WEATHER FORECAST as of Sunday, 07 December 2025) At 3:00 AM today, the center of Tropical Depression "WILMA" was estimated based on all available data in the vicinity of Matuguinao, Samar (12.2°N 125.0°E) with maximum sustained winds of 45 km/h near the center and gustiness of up to 75 km/h. It is moving West Northwestward at 15 km/h. Shear Line affecting the eastern section of Southern Luzon. Northeast Monsoon affecting the rest of Luzon. Mindanao will have partly cloudy to cloudy skies with isolated rainshowers or thunderstorms due to Localized Thunderstorms. Possible flash floods or landslides during severe thunderstorms. Moderate to strong winds from northeast to northwest will prevail over the western sections of Mindanao with moderate to rough seas (1.2 to 3.1 meters). Elsewhere, moderate winds from the northwest to southwest to southeast with moderate seas (1.2 to 2.5 meters).

DepEd-13, Agusan Sur LGU meet for 2026 Palarong Pambansa

AGUSAN DEL SUR -- To ensure the successful holding of the Palarong Pambansa in 2026 in the province of Agusan del Sur, Governor Santiago Cane Jr. and the Department of Education (DepEd) led by Caraga Director Maria Ines Asuncion held a meeting with the technical working group (TWG) responsible for the event. 

The meeting at the Provincial Governor's Office (PGO) conference room was attended by various stakeholders, key figures from the education sector and the provincial government, and sports experts to discuss plans, strategies, and preparations.

The premier annual multi-sport event for elementary and high school students in the Philippines, plays a critical role in the development of athletes and in promoting sportsmanship, discipline, and unity among the Filipino youth. 

Gov. Cane emphasized on the importance of early preparation and collaboration among various agencies and local government units.

The meeting served as a platform for updating stakeholders on the progress of the preparations, discussing logistical challenges, and ensuring that all necessary resources are in place for the successful staging of the games. 

Dir. Asuncion outlined their roles in ensuring that all aspects of the event, from the selection of venues, billeting quarters to transportation and security measures are meticulously planned and executed.

Discussions included the measures to be taken for crowd control, emergency preparedness, and healthcare provisions.

The group also discussed the importance of securing sponsorships and forming partnerships with the private sector to support the event with their resources and expertise.

The governor further emphasized the need for sustainable practices in organizing the event, such as reducing waste, ensuring eco-friendly facilities, and promoting the use of local products and services.

Asuncion expressed confidence that with the strong involvement of all stakeholders, the 2026 edition of the event will be a testament to the unity and resilience of the Filipino spirit in sports. (PPIO Agusan del Sur/PIA-Agusan del Sur)
